1975 Fiat 130 vs. 1992 Ford Escort

To start off, 1992 Ford Escort is newer by 17 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1975 Fiat 130.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1975 Fiat 130 would be higher. At 3,235 cc (6 cylinders), 1975 Fiat 130 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1975 Fiat 130 (165 HP @ 5600 RPM) has 77 more horse power than 1992 Ford Escort. (88 HP @ 4400 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1975 Fiat 130 should accelerate faster than 1992 Ford Escort.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1992 Ford Escort weights approximately 100 kg more than 1975 Fiat 130.

Because 1975 Fiat 130 is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1975 Fiat 130.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1992 Ford Escort,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1975 Fiat 130 (249 Nm @ 3400 RPM) has 103 more torque (in Nm) than 1992 Ford Escort. (146 Nm @ 3800 RPM). This means 1975 Fiat 130 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1992 Ford Escort.
